CRJ - 10/28/2016 03:06

Sorry but you would be wrong on that. The efficiency of the wide head, or any wide implement for that matter, comes from less trips thru the field and less turning. While he may have to use a slower forward speed he would still be more efficient than the 40 footer, all else equal.


5' on a head isn't the same as comparing a 16 row to a 24 row planter or something like that. You can drive the exact same speed with the planter. All you are gaining with a 45' is less turns.

other thing is I haven't seen anything that will spread straw out evenly on a 40' let alone a 45'.
